Crynodeb
Conduct regular evaluations of the portals UI/UX to identify potential improvements. Work with developers and designers to implement changes based on patient feedback. Collect, analyse, and act on patient feedback gathered through surveys, interviews, and questionnaires.Identify common issues and concerns raised by users and suggest improvements to enhance satisfaction. Promote new features, particularly the waiting list initiative, specific condition surveillance, and video consultation functionality within the Attend Anywhere system. Provide tutorials, FAQs, and direct assistance to guide patients through new functionalities. Work with other internal teams, including the IT and IG departments to ensure the Patient Portal complies with all relevant healthcare regulations (e.g., GDPR, HIPAA). Regularly review the portals security infrastructure and implement improvements as necessary and maintain a secure environment for patient data. Work alongside the OPD ERS & Applications Manager and the OPD ERS & Applications Support to maintain the ERS system and Cerner clinic build functionality to allow compatibility with the Patient Portal appointment functionality. Track key metrics on patient interaction, feature adoption, and overall satisfaction. Provide regular reports on patient engagement and portal performance to senior management.
